Hi All,

I have just brought Starters Orders 7.

And as a big racing fan as I am, I have no idea what I am doing with this game.

I am starting in the trainer/owner mode where I have just three horses.

What should I be doing with the 100k that is in the bank. Do I buy horses straight away or persevere with the 3 I have? Do I build the facilities?

Sometimes my account balance just drops even though I have not done anything.

How frequently should I be racing the horses? What do I need to do to actually win races. Does it matter if I pick a jockey with a cheap riding fee or not? I need to give jockey instructions to give myself a better chance. Do I need to start my horses in maidens or just stick them straight into handicaps they are eligible for?

I did one whole season on the flat and my balance went into minus by the end of it. So I am doing something wrong.

All the help would be greatly appreciated as I feel like I have wasted £25 and not got what I wanted out of the game.

To quickly answer some of your specific questions:

Wait until the fitness and conditions bars are back at 100%, i normally race about once a month, maybe a little sooner if there is a feature race.
I do not often give jockey instructions (maybe only "do not lead").
Picking a good jockey will give you better post race feedback, and might help a little in the race. I would not worry until you are established as it all costs money.
As already stated, start in "easy mode", you will get 5 horses. Consider starting a game over and over until you are given some half decent horses. Look for ones that have come from Group One winning parents and unless their stats are amazing sell them before you race them.

Get that breeding barn as soon as you can. Selling your foals is the key to getting established financially IMO.
SO7 is more simulator than arcade game, sure it can be tough for the first couple of seasons, but once you get going its easy(ish) to succeed.

Go into your finance and it will tell you how much your yard is costing each week. Your bank balance will erode even if you don't do anything I'm afraid because you have running costs. I have sent you a pm about finance so check that out.

To sell a horse go to it's profile page and you will see a small blue box. Click it to enter that horse into the next auction. Before clicking you can enter a reserve value.

To get horses to green from amber you need to increase their training load. Set to red and things will change though it could take 10 days or so depending on the fitness of the horse initially.

It appears you are making life hard for yourself.
Do this: Start a new game in "EASY" mode.
On the next screen make sure the "Simple Training Mode" is active. This means you dont have to worry about manually keeping the horses fitness in the green.

Selling a horse (send to auction) is the little icon with the "A" on the horse details page. Its located just under the "retire from game" option. Click the "A" icon.
Do not ride your horse in races until you have worked out the basics of the game.

I strongly suggest you find the "so7instructions.pdf" file in the main game directory. It will help you alot
Just jumping in and expecting to succeed in this game is like trying to play a flight simulator without learning the controls.
Its not that hard but you need to do a little reading of that PDF.
